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General »

Access xp

Estas en el tema de Access xp en el foro de Bases de Datos General en Foros del Web. Cambiar de versión tiene sus cosas, y la primera es, que en mi código, yo tenía un bonito dim db as database, rs as recordset ...
  #1 (permalink)  
Antiguo 12/03/2004, 04:31
 
Fecha de Ingreso: abril-2003
Ubicación: Madrid
Mensajes: 707
Antigüedad: 21 años, 7 meses
Puntos: 0
Access xp

Cambiar de versión tiene sus cosas, y la primera es, que en mi código, yo tenía un bonito

dim db as database, rs as recordset

set db = currentdb()

set rs = db.openrecordset "SELECT * FROM Tabla 1", dbopendynaset

Pues bien, eso seguiría funcionando si mantengo las referencias a los objetos DAO, pero no es de recibo, y ahora es cuando empiezan los problemas.

He cambiado ese código, y lo he dejado así:

dim db as new adodb.connection, rs as new adodb.recordset

db.open currentproject.connection
rs.open "SELECT * FROM Tabla1", db, adOpenDynamic, adLockOptimistic

Es esta la forma correcta de hacer las cosas ahora????

Un saludo y gracias
  #2 (permalink)  
Antiguo 12/03/2004, 09:08
Avatar de claudiovega  
Fecha de Ingreso: octubre-2003
Ubicación: Puerto Montt
Mensajes: 3.667
Antigüedad: 21 años, 1 mes
Puntos: 11
si, esa es la nueva forma usando Ado. Se puede cuidar el rendimiento usando las propiedades de los cursores y del bloqueo.

dbopendynaset <=> adopenkeyset
__________________
Dedicado a proyectos web, actualmente desarrollando un sistema de diseño de flyers online muy fácil de usar.
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 14:19.